Rebuilding  Together in Your Community
Today I was a community volunteer!  My husband and I participated in Rebuilding Together- Calcasieu with our church team, Trinity Baptist Church in Lake Charles.  The church sponsored 3 homes in North Lake Charles. Volunteers become plumbers, painters, construction workers for a day. There are many other sponsors in Lake Charles who organize teams.  April 24 is National Rebuilding Together day across the country.
